Overview

Located nearly 20 minutes' walk from Eastgate Shopping Centre, No 27 Bed & Breakfast Inverness is around 5 minutes' walk from St Michael & All Angels. There is also parking.

Location

The centre of Inverness can be reached within a 10-minute walk. River Ness is merely 0.7 km from this bed & breakfast, and Caledonian Thistle Soccer Club is about a 25-minute walk away. The hotel is situated within close distance of Victorian Market, and Inverness bus station lies only a 10-minute walk away.

Rooms

Some rooms are fitted with a private bathroom.

Eat & Drink

Guests can dine at the café Jammy Piece, which is just 0.6 km away.

    The owner at No 27 Bed & Breakfast truly made our stay enjoyable. He was incredibly friendly and funny. Arriving early, we were pleasantly surprised when he showed up within five minutes to show us our room even though we didn’t expect it to be ready. The room was cute and cozy, featuring a queen bed ideal for two friends traveling together. A kettle with tea, coffee, and complimentary snacks added a nice touch. The bathroom was fine, equipped with sinks in the room. Breakfast was a standout with options to order anything warm alongside a plentiful spread. It's a short walk to central Inverness, but the area isn’t the prettiest. One downside was some noise from the busy street outside our window, but it didn't ruin our experience. I’d definitely return for the charming atmosphere and great service.
